GENERAL STATEMENT OF POSITION:

Under limited supervision, is responsible for all aspects of resident care including initial and ongoing assessments; hiring, training, supervising, managing and coordinating resident Care Assistants.

SCOPE: Supervisory Responsibility: Supervise the resident care team of the community that includes the following positions:

  • Medication Services Technicians
  • Care Assistants
  • Resident Care Coordinator

BUDGET RESPONSIBILITY: Responsible for meeting budget goals, expenses and established care thresholds for the resident

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

The following duties are normal for this position. These are not exclusive or all-inclusive. Other duties may be required and assigned.

  • Hires and provides orientation for new Care Assistants; ensuring that staffing levels are maintained
  • Evaluates medication orders and translates them for Medication Services Technicians and residents as needed
  • Supervises and evaluates assistants on all shifts, providing counseling and written disciplinary and/or corrective action when needed
  • Provides in-service training for resident assistants on a routine basis and one-to-one training as needed
  • Assesses potential residents for appropriateness prior to move-in and provides on-going written assessments of all residents
  • Develops and maintains Care/Service Plans for each resident, updating as diagnosis/condition changes
  • Creates and maintains resident care communication system to ensure quality care on each shift
  • Manages electronic reporting system, occurrence and situational reporting and Medication Administration Records
  • Monitors centrally stored medication system
  • Manages employee uniform/scrub program
  • Develops resident care policies and protocols as needed
  • Monitors resident rooms, dining room, living room, attendant station, bathing rooms and medication rooms ensuring they are clean and orderly
  • Monitors supplies on hand, including linens and towels and orders as necessary
  • Provides first aid to residents when needed
  • Communicates with physicians and families on resident’s change of condition or incident
  • Accepts physician orders or order changes for medication or treatment, calls orders to pharmacy
  • Assesses residents for needed medical intervention and arranges medical visits to doctor’s offices or emergency room
  • Maintains current resident emergency records with up-to-date information
  • Monitors the emergency call system and ensures staff responds appropriately
  • Supervises resident meals and monitors for appropriate diets
  • Assists with emergencies and with safety instructions for residents such as fire drills, etc.
  • Maintains current knowledge of state and local regulations, ensuring community compliance
  • Answers telephones, assists visitors and gives tours to prospective residents
  • Performs duties as manager on duty on a rotating basis
  • Conducts work tasks safely and in compliance with the community safety program
  • Provides effective and courteous service to all residents, guests and co-workers
  • Performs other related essential duties as required
  • Attend in-service training and workshops and meetings as required.
  • Promote and protect the rights of each resident
